Real Estate Report - February
/Our January report focused mostly on 2020’s annual statistics. This report will put most of its attention on quarterly and monthly indicators, which better illustrate changes occurring as 2020 progressed: pre-pandemic to initial pandemic crash through the subsequent market recovery. In some counties - and of course, Sonoma is one of them - the terrible fires of late summer, early autumn also affected market dynamics to varying degrees.
The 2021 market began with a bang: The number of listings going into contract in January was more than 50% higher than in January 2020, a tremendous increase. As is the norm, new listing activity climbed from the typical annual low point in December.
